Aggravated assault threat or refers to a legal allegation involving an individual making threats of serious harm or injury to another person, typically involving the use of a weapon or intent to cause significant bodily harm.
Typically, law enforcement officers, victims of the threat, or concerned witnesses are required to file an aggravated assault threat report. It may also be filed by attorneys representing victims or the state.
To fill out an aggravated assault threat report, one should gather all relevant information including details of the incident, identification of involved parties, location, date and time of the threat, and any evidence or witnesses. The completed report is then submitted to the appropriate law enforcement agency.
The purpose of an aggravated assault threat report is to document the threat formally, initiate an investigation, and potentially lead to criminal charges against the individual making the threat, ensuring the safety of the victim and the community.
The report must include the name and contact information of the victim, name of the alleged perpetrator, a detailed description of the threat, circumstances surrounding the incident, location, date and time it occurred, and details of any witnesses or evidence related to the threat.
